共 3 篇文章

标签:api接口

文件云存储地址怎么获取-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

文件云存储地址怎么获取

文件云存储地址的获取,通常涉及到云存储服务提供商的相关API接口调用,不同的云存储服务提供商可能会有不同的API接口和参数设置,但大体上,获取文件云存储地址的步骤可以概括为以下几个部分:,1、注册并登录云存储服务,,你需要在目标云存储服务提供商的网站上注册一个账号,并进行登录,这一步通常是免费的,但某些高级功能可能需要付费。,2、创建存储空间,登录后,你需要创建一个存储空间,存储空间可以理解为一个文件夹,用于存放你的文件,你可以根据需要创建多个存储空间,每个存储空间都有自己的独立访问权限和URL。,3、上传文件,在创建了存储空间后,你就可以将本地的文件上传到这个存储空间中,上传文件的方式通常有两种:一是通过网页版的上传按钮,二是通过API接口调用。,4、获取文件的URL,上传文件后,你可以通过API接口调用来获取这个文件的URL,这个URL就是文件在云存储中的地址,你可以通过这个地址来访问这个文件。,,具体的API接口调用方式,需要参考云存储服务提供商的官方文档,你需要提供一些必要的参数,如你的Access Key、Secret Key、存储空间的ID和文件的ID等,这些参数通常在你创建存储空间或上传文件时会生成。,如果你使用的是Amazon S3作为云存储服务提供商,那么获取文件URL的API接口调用方式如下:,在这个例子中, my-bucket是你的存储空间的名称, my-key是你要获取URL的文件的名称,执行这个命令后,你会得到一个JSON格式的响应,其中包含了文件的URL。,5、使用文件URL,获取到文件URL后,你就可以通过这个URL来访问这个文件了,你可以在浏览器中直接输入这个URL,或者在你的程序中使用这个URL来下载或显示这个文件。,以上就是获取文件云存储地址的基本步骤,需要注意的是,不同的云存储服务提供商可能会有不同的API接口和参数设置,所以在实际操作时,你需要参考你所使用的云存储服务提供商的官方文档。, 相关问题与解答,,1、Q: 我在使用Google Cloud Storage时,为什么无法获取到文件的URL?,A: Google Cloud Storage的文件URL是通过特殊的签名算法生成的,所以你无法直接通过API接口获取到文件的URL,你需要先获取到文件的签名字符串,然后将其添加到文件的URL中,才能得到正确的文件URL,具体的签名算法和参数设置,可以参考Google Cloud Storage的官方文档。,2、Q: 我在使用Dropbox时,为什么无法通过API接口获取到文件的URL?,A: Dropbox的文件URL是通过特殊的链接生成的,所以你无法直接通过API接口获取到文件的URL,你需要先获取到文件的链接,然后将其添加到你的网页或程序中,才能让用户访问到这个文件,具体的链接生成方式和参数设置,可以参考Dropbox的官方文档。

互联网+
网页怎么调用c语言-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

网页怎么调用c语言

网页调用C语言,通常是指将C语言编写的程序嵌入到网页中,以实现特定的功能,这种方式在很多年前是非常流行的,但随着JavaScript等前端技术的发展,现在已经有了更多的选择,但在某些场景下,如嵌入式设备、服务器端渲染等,C语言仍然具有不可替代的优势,下面将详细介绍如何在网页中调用C语言。,1、CGI(Common Gateway Interface),CGI是一种允许网页与服务器上的程序进行交互的技术,通过CGI,我们可以在网页中调用C语言编写的程序,以下是一个简单的C语言CGI程序示例:,将上述代码保存为 cgibin/your_program.c,并确保其具有可执行权限,在网页中添加一个链接,指向 http://your_website.com/cgibin/your_program,当用户点击该链接时,服务器将执行 your_program.c中的代码,并将结果返回给浏览器。,2、WebAssembly,WebAssembly是一种可以在浏览器中运行的低级虚拟机代码,它支持多种编程语言,包括C语言,要使用WebAssembly,首先需要将C语言代码编译为WebAssembly模块,可以使用Emscripten工具来实现这一点,以下是一个简单的示例:,安装Emscripten:,创建一个名为 main.c的C语言文件,内容如下:,使用Emscripten编译C语言代码为WebAssembly:,

CDN资讯